TOOLS AND PARTS REQUIRED
(NOT SUPPLIED)
#2 Phillips screwdriver
Hand held drill
High speed drill bit, 3/32" diameter
3/8" slot head screwdriver
Level
Saw
2x4 or 2x2 lumber for installing runners
or 3/8" plywood for floor (if required)
Wood screws or other hardware for installing
runner or shelf to support oven (if required)
Safety glasses or goggles
PARTS SUPPLIED
6 brass screws (3 required, 3 extra)
5 color matched screws (4 required, 1 extra)
Bottom trim
ELECTRICAL TOOLS AND PARTS
REQUIRED (NOT SUPPLIED)
Junction box
Electrical cable (3-conductor or 4-conductor wire
as required by local codes)
UL-listed conduit connectors
Wire cutters and wire strippers
ADVANCE PLANNING
These ovens may be installed directly into a 30”
wide oven cabinet.
Cutout dimensions are NOT the same for
installation with or without an accessory storage
drawer. Make sure to use the correct cutout when
preparing the opening.
NOTE: Model ZSC2202 CANNOT be installed
with an accessory storage drawer. See Installation
Preparation Without an Accessory Storage Drawer
for this model.
IMPORTANT This oven is not
approved for use above another built-in
Advantium Speedcook oven, a side by side
installation or below a countertop.
For personal safety, this oven cannot be
installed in a cabinet arrangement such as an
island or peninsula.
The oven must be installed at least 36-3/4”
above the floor.
Allow for clearance to adjacent corners, walls,
drawers, etc.
Cabinets installed adjacent to wall ovens
must have an adhesion spec of at least 194ºF
temperature rating.
The oven must be securely installed in a cabinet
that is firmly attached to the house structure.
Weight on the oven door could cause the oven
to tip and result in injury. Never allow anyone to
climb, sit, stand or hang on the oven door.
If installing the drawer accessory, the drawer
must be assembled to the oven prior to
installation into the cabinet. See the Accessory
Storage Drawer Assembly Instructions.
